What is a Car Transponder Key?
A transponder key is an automotive key which contains a microchip embedded within it. This microchip interacts with the vehicle's ignition system. The main function of a transponder key is to prevent unauthorized gain access to and minimize the risk of vehicle theft. When the key is inserted, the vehicle's ignition system reads the chip, and if it recognizes the proper code, the engine starts.

A car transponder key programmer is a gadget that allows users to program brand-new keys or reprogram existing ones. Here's an easy overview of how these programmers work:
Key Identification: The programmer determines the kind of vehicle and the existing key and transponder system.Interaction: It develops a connection with the vehicle's on-board computer system through the OBD-II port.Programming: The programmer can develop new keys, delete old ones from the system, or bring back lost keys.Process of Programming a Transponder KeyAction 1: Tool Setup: Connect the key programmer to the vehicle's OBD-II port.Step 2: Power On: Power on the vehicle without beginning the engine.Step 3: Select Vehicle: Use the programmer to select the make and model of the vehicle.Step 4: Read Keys: The programmer checks out the existing keys and transponder codes.Step 5: Programming New Key: Follow the on-screen prompts to program brand-new keys.Step 6: Testing: Once new keys are programmed, check them to ensure they work.Advantages of Using Transponder Key Programmers

The majority of contemporary automobiles, especially those produced after the late 1990s, are compatible with transponder key programming. However, it's important to verify compatibility with your particular make and design.
Can I program a key without the initial?
Some key programmers can produce a new key without the initial by utilizing the vehicle's V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) or other techniques. However, this procedure can be more complex and may not apply for all vehicles.
Is it safe to utilize third-party key programmers?
Using respectable third-party key programmers is normally safe. Nevertheless, it is important to guarantee the tool works with your vehicle and to follow producer directions thoroughly.
Just how much does a car transponder key programmer cost?
Prices for car transponder key programmers can vary significantly based upon brand, functionality, and functions. Entry-level models may begin at around ₤ 30, while advanced devices can surpass ₤ 200.
